Remi Wolf Announces Third Album 'Mud'

Wednesday, 19 August 2026 Written by Jon Stickler

Photo: Zachary Gray

Remi Wolf has announced her third album.

'Mud', the follow-up to 2024's 'Big Ideas', is set for release on October 9 via Island Records, with the new song Bottle set to drop tomorrow (August 20).

Featuring 11 tracks, including the previously unveiled lead single Twiggy, the album first started to come together after years of touring, writing and recording, with the California alt-pop artist finding inspiration from early sessions in Nashville before heading to the mountain resort region of Big Bear with longtime collaborator Jared Solomon and friends Jack DeMeo, Jamie McLaughlin and Gigi Grombacher.

The group reunited at New York's Electric Lady Studios before heading to Joshua Tree to finish the record, focusing on live instrumentation and recording together in the same room, with Wolf sometimes playing drums herself. She shared:

"I feel like I've crossed into a new phase of life because of this album.  I literally felt like I was covered in shit. And now, at the end of the album process, I feel so clean and clear. It has been a very cleansing record to make for me."

Wolf will play shows in Australia this December as part of the Spilt Milk Festival. Earlier this year, she made her on-screen debut in the Amazon Prime Video series Off Campus, which features multiple songs by her and a cameo in the premiere episode.
